Interactive Aerosol Feedbacks on Photolysis Rates in the GEM-MACH v2.4 Air Quality Model in Canadian Urban and Industrial Areas

The photolysis module in Environment and Climate Change Canada’s on-line chemical transport model GEM-MACH (GEM: Global Environmental Multi-scale – MACH: Modelling Air quality and Chemistry) was improved, to make use of the on-line size and composition-resolved representation of atmospheric aerosols...
